How Birds Fly: Research in Action with Dr. Natalie Wright

Join Kenyon Associate Professor of Biology Dr. Natalie Wright for an inside look at the science of bird flight. Learn how birds fly, how researchers study flight, and what current research is revealing about subtle anatomical differences that affect how birds move. The program includes a short talk followed by live observation using high-speed video to study birds visiting the BFEC feeders and discuss what scientists look for when studying flight. Ideal for anyone curious about birds, biomechanics, and hands-on, field-based research. Meet in the Resource Center.
